Written in partnership with the Interfaith Roundtable

Written in partnership with the Interfaith Roundtable of the Salt Lake Organizing Committee for the Olympic Winter Games of 2002, A World Of Faith offers one-page descriptions of a wide variety of beliefs, succinctly summarzing the core tenets and practices of each belief for young readers. Simple illustrations mark this enjoyable reference for young children, which explains the very basics of Buddhism, Islam, Taoism, Hinduism, and many other beliefs including the ways of those who practice different forms Christianity - Jehovahs Witnesses, Unitarians, Pentecostals, and much more.

Its a wonderful world

This is a wonderful book to teach children and adults (!) the BASIC origin and beliefs of many religions throughout the world. The illustrations are beautiful! The text on each page isnt too long which helps in keeping the interest of children. The religions are listed alphabetically with a picture on the left hand side and about 1/2 page of text on the right. It is quite pricey, and although I was given a copy of the book, I would recommend purchasing it. (I was planning on buying it.) Its hard to put a price on spiritual knowledge. In a world FULL of diversity, it is essential to educate ourselves and our children as to the differences and similarities of people throughout the world (and in our own country). Education and knowledge bridge the gap of discrimination.
